IL Archer said:
Glad you like it, asylum. :( I haven't seen one in person yet, but I'd like to. How's the draw cycle compare to the Guardian?
well,i havent shot a guardian enough to really give you an accurate comparison...when i did shoot the guardian,i thought it was a little harsh on the draw...but,i was used to shooting my ross...when i shot the guardian,i had a few month lay off from shooting bows so my muscles werent used to it...to me,the x-force draw feels like a 334 at 74#...the difference is the 334 doesnt pull as hard at the end of the draw cycle...the x-force has a super hard wall and a fairly short valley...i think pse is going to sell alot of high end bows this year

I shot one in my friends PSE shop a couple of weeks ago and it's blistering fast! Took some skin off me but for a speed bow with a 6" brace height it was comfortable to shoot, solid wall. He had his dialed in @ 70# and had .015" between his 20 and 40 yd. pins no room for a 30. I can't remember the numbers off the top of my head but I think it was 351fps with a 360 grain arrow @ 70#.
